AppleScript是一种脚本语言,用于自动化Mac操作系统中的各种任务。它可以与Safari浏览器进行交互,实现对网页的操作和信息提取。
在Safari中,要获取当前打开的网页的URL或网页标题,可以使用以下AppleScript代码:
tell application "Safari"
set currentTab to current tab of front window
set pageURL to URL of currentTab
set pageTitle to name of currentTab
end tell
上述代码首先通过tell application "Safari"
语句指定了要操作的应用程序为Safari。然后,使用current tab of front window
获取当前活动窗口的当前标签页。接着,使用URL of currentTab
获取当前标签页的URL,使用name of currentTab
获取当前标签页的标题。
通过上述代码,可以获取到当前打开的网页的URL和标题,然后可以根据需要进行进一步的处理或操作。
对于AppleScript在Safari中未获得URL或网页标题的问题,可能是由于以下原因导致的:
希望以上信息对您有所帮助。如果您需要进一步了解AppleScript或其他相关内容,可以参考腾讯云的开发者文档和资源:
领取专属 10元无门槛券
手把手带您无忧上云